The Book Lover's Guide to Collecting by Leon T. Curtis is a comprehensive resource tailored for avid book collectors and enthusiasts. It offers practical advice, historical insights, and strategies for building, managing, and expanding a personal book collection. The guide covers various collecting niches, from rare editions to specialized genres, and provides guidance on valuation, preservation, and sourcing rare titles.
